Title: Heat Recovery System
Project Cost: 1.8 Crore
Period: Nov-14 –June15
Description: TATA MOTORS LTD. , India’s largest commercial vehicle manufacturing company has achieved higher
environment friendly manufacturing in its Lucknow plant through its initiative of reducing Co2 emission from its production
process by 25% ,
New “Waste heat recovery system “ was installed in plant paint Shop in month of July 2015 to recover waste heat from E.D. &
Top coat oven. The sustainable results of this project were achieved by generating hot water using the exhaust flue gases which
are vented out at 320 degree centigrade
This hot water is then used for heating application in Pre-treatment process in the Paint Shop itself. As a result, 80% reduction for
hot water generation for this purpose was achieved that saved 75 kg/hr. of propane Gas consumption (Energy equivalent to
828100 KCAL/hr) On an average this translates to the energy consumed by nearly 2200 Indian households in a year. Total
savings in terms of money is INR 22721859
Equivalent to US $ 354887 . To achieve this a shell & tube heat exchanger is installed at the exhaust of oven through a diverter valve
which diverts hot flue gases to heat exchanger which in turns recovers heat of flue gases to heat water up to 85
degree Celsius . In total 131 cubic meter/Hr. of water is heated to 85 degree Celsius
